The post about using Linux while blind (https://fireborn.mataroa.blog/blog/i-want-to-love-linux-it-doesnt-love-me-back-post-1-built-for-control-but-not-for-people/) contains a sentence that really stood out to me as being true in so many aspects of my life.
"We’re not waiting on unknowns.
We’re waiting on maintenance."
There's so much interest in "innovation." Anything can be fixed with apps, AI, wearables. Right?
But when I've asked blind people what makes it hard for them to walk in their neighborhoods, it's broken pavements and overhanging greenery. Councils can't afford maintenance.
